A cheapskate option is to find a nice example of an Epiphone EB-0 and mod it. My 2017 one plays as good as any Gibson SG I've had my hands on (several through the years). Adding a bridge pickup is easy, and economical with the savings compared to spending Gibson money, and you can customize the wiring to your liking.
